Welcome to crime data report for St. Stephen, Minnesota, an area with a population of 817 residents. In this data exploration, we will delve into the crime statistics of St. Stephen, Minnesota shedding light on its safety and security. The closest law enforcement agency from St. Stephen is Sauk Rapids Police Department (MN0050200) approximately around 10.65 miles away from the center of St. Stephen.

This analysis uses the latest crime data submitted by Sauk Rapids Police Department to the FBI National Incident-Based Reporting System (NIBRS).

Note: In area with small number of population such as St. Stephen, the data might be skewed in infrequent crimes such as homicide, rape, and arson.

Total Crime in St. Stephen, Minnesota

A comprehensive overview of the overall crime landscape, covering a range of different criminal activities within a specific region.

Chart of Total Crime in St. Stephen, Minnesota from 2012 to 2022

In St. Stephen, the crime rate displayed a decline in, peaking in 2015 (2818.78) and bottoming out in 2018 (43.31). In Minnesota, there was a notable decrease in trend, with the highest recorded in 2012 (2789.88) and the lowest observed in 2018 (2213.33). In United States, the crime rate exhibited a declining trend, reaching its highest point in 2013 (3519.17) and then hitting its lowest point in 2021 (1689.67).

A -33.58% lower total crime rate in St. Stephen compared to the state average (1626.39 vs 2448.76) highlights positive community efforts. The incidence of total crime was -44.16% below the national average (1626.39 vs 2912.43).

Violent Crime in St. Stephen, Minnesota

Insights into intense and forceful criminal acts, including assault, robbery, homicide, and rape, shedding light on the most serious offenses.

Chart of Violent Crime in St. Stephen, Minnesota from 2012 to 2022

In St. Stephen, the crime rate exhibited a declining trend, reaching its highest point in 2020 (195.8) and then hitting its lowest point in 2018 (43.31). In Minnesota, the crime rate displayed an increase, bottoming out in 2018 (220.42) and peaking in 2021(307.39). The trend in United States followed a decreasing pattern, with the peak occurring in 2016 (446.76) and the lowest point observed in 2021 (281.24).

In St. Stephen, the rate of violent crime was -63.67% lower than the state average (89.63 vs 246.73). A -77.92% lower violent crime rate compared to the national average (89.63 vs 405.94) highlights positive community efforts.
